Baltimore, MD — The heart of Baltimore is pounding with pride tonight. Terrell Suggs — the fierce, relentless linebacker who defined a generation of Baltimore Ravens football — has officially been nominated for the Pro Football Hall of Fame Class of 2026.

Known to fans as “T-Sizzle,” Suggs wasn’t just a player — he was an identity. For 17 incredible seasons, he brought chaos to opposing offenses, leading with his trademark aggression, unmatched instincts, and the swagger that embodied what it means to be a Raven. From strip-sacks to Super Bowl glory, Suggs’ legacy was built on one simple truth: he never backed down from anyone.

During his career, Suggs recorded 139 career sacksseven Pro Bowl selections, and was crowned NFL Defensive Player of the Year in 2011. More than the stats, though, it was his leadership — that raw fire in the locker room and on the field — that made him unforgettable.
